Nearly a Half-Million Viewers Tune in to Blue Grass

More than 435,000 households viewed ESPN's broadcast of three key Kentucky Derby (gr. I) prep races April 14. The 5-6 p.m. broadcast earned a 0.55 rating for its coverage of the Toyota Blue Grass Stakes (gr. I), the Arkansas Derby (gr. II), and the Wood Memorial (gr. II).
The rating cannot be compared with last year when the races were carried on ABC. Last year, the race earned a 1.6 rating and attracted 1,608,000 households.
The prep races did attract more viewers than the NHL first round playoff game on ESPN2, which earned a 0.4 rating and had 297,000 households tuned in. During the time slot, the races had competition from a Senior PGA tournament on ABC, the PGA Worldcom Classic on CBS, and the American Le Mans auto race on NBC.
